Transaction 80a99977e997c9e422afc63c04dd1f0d4f22ff1b2e52a8624033908dacaac646
1 Input
1 Output
-
80a99977e997c9e422afc63c04dd1f0d4f22ff1b2e52a8624033908dacaac646:0
- value
- 131395
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de7f078ce602a130d187df96c83b6bb41b16a69d OP_EQUAL
- address
- 3MyU7J1Uc7AtmnnA17X5SjgPbp6GnwfYmP